Wednesday, Wall Street Journal reported that Microsoft recently held
meetings that discussed about buying a stake in Internet Media Company
Yahoo. This aims to compete against Google.

Wall Street
Journal reported that Microsoft and Yahoo have been holding discussions
about possible options over the past year. There is a possibility that
MSN online network will be sold to Yahoo and Microsoft will take a
small stake in the Internet Portal. Both Yahoo and Microsoft remain
silent about these discussions.

On the other hand, Microsoft
and AOL had talks about AOL using Microsoft's search technology. This
will give AOL a boost on their business.
